Students from nine Kansas high schools will be honored Thursday, Oct. 10, by the University of Kansas Alumni Association and KU Endowment.
A total of 50 seniors from high schools in Ellis, Rooks, Russell and Trego counties will be recognized for their academic achievements and named Kansas Honor Scholars at a 6:30 p.m. dinner and program at Hays High School, 2300 E. 13th Street.

Timothy Caboni, vice chancellor for public affairs at the University of Kansas, will speak to the students and their parents and guests.
Community volunteers collect reservations, coordinate details and serve as local contacts for the event. Shiela Brening, of Hays, is the site coordinator. Alan and Lori Moore, of Hays, are the Ellis County coordinators.
Tom and Cassie Nuckols, of Plainville, are the Rooks County coordinators.
Nancy Lane, of Russell, is the Russell County coordinator.
Jim and Kathy Cleland, of WaKeeney, are the Trego County coordinators.
Since 1971, the Kansas Honors Program has recognized more than 120,000 scholars, who rank in the top 10 percent of their high school senior classes and are selected regardless of occupational plans or higher-education goals.
